Essential Skills for Effective Cardiovascular Care

The Postgraduate Certificate in Cardiovascular Disease Prevention and Management focuses on imparting a range of essential skills that are crucial for managing cardiovascular health. These skills go beyond textbook knowledge and include practical applications that make a tangible difference in patient outcomes.

1. Clinical Assessment and Diagnosis:

Mastering the art of clinical assessment is fundamental. You'll learn to accurately diagnose cardiovascular conditions by interpreting electrocardiograms (ECGs), echocardiograms, and other diagnostic tools. This skill ensures that you can promptly identify and address issues, leading to better patient care.

2. Risk Factor Management:

Understanding and managing risk factors is key to preventing cardiovascular diseases. You'll gain expertise in assessing lifestyle choices, genetic predispositions, and environmental factors that contribute to cardiovascular issues. This involves educating patients on the importance of diet, exercise, and stress management, as well as monitoring and managing conditions like hypertension and diabetes.

3. Evidence-Based Practice:

The program emphasizes evidence-based practice, ensuring that your decisions are grounded in the latest research. You'll learn to critically evaluate medical literature, conduct systematic reviews, and apply best practices to your clinical work. This approach fosters continuous improvement and innovation in cardiovascular care.

4. Patient Communication and Education:

Effective communication is crucial for building trust and ensuring patient compliance. You'll develop the skills to explain complex medical information in a clear and understandable manner, fostering a collaborative relationship with patients. Education is a powerful tool in preventing cardiovascular diseases, and you'll learn how to empower patients to take control of their health.

Best Practices in Cardiovascular Disease Prevention

Best practices in cardiovascular disease prevention are constantly evolving, driven by advancements in medical research and technology. The program ensures you are up-to-date with the latest guidelines and techniques.

1. Comprehensive Lifestyle Interventions:

Lifestyle plays a pivotal role in cardiovascular health. You'll learn to design comprehensive lifestyle interventions that include dietary modifications, exercise regimens, and stress reduction techniques. These interventions are tailored to individual needs, ensuring a holistic approach to prevention.

2. Pharmacological Management:

Understanding the role of medication in managing cardiovascular diseases is essential. You'll gain insights into the latest pharmacological treatments, their mechanisms of action, and potential side effects. This knowledge enables you to prescribe and monitor medications effectively, optimizing patient outcomes.

3. Community and Public Health Initiatives:

Prevention extends beyond the clinical setting. You'll explore community and public health initiatives aimed at reducing the incidence of cardiovascular diseases. This includes public awareness campaigns, school-based programs, and workplace health initiatives. These efforts create a supportive environment for maintaining cardiovascular health.
